引言

在几何学中,三角函数是解决各种几何问题的强大工具。它们能够帮助我们计算角度、长度、面积等几何量。本文将深入探讨三角函数的应用,特别是如何使用它们来求解阴影角集合,从而解决各种几何难题。

一、三角函数基础知识

1. 正弦(sin)、余弦(cos)和正切(tan)

三角函数是描述直角三角形边长之间关系的一类函数。对于一个直角三角形,假设一个角度为θ,那么:

  • 正弦(sin)定义为对边与斜边的比值:sin(θ) = 对边 / 斜边
  • 余弦(cos)定义为邻边与斜边的比值:cos(θ) = 邻边 / 斜边
  • 正切(tan)定义为对边与邻边的比值:tan(θ) = 对边 / 邻边

2. 反三角函数

反三角函数是三角函数的逆运算,用于求解角度。常见的反三角函数包括:

-反正弦(arcsin)或反正切(arctan)

  • 余弦反函数(arccos)

二、求解阴影角集合

1. 阴影角概念

阴影角是指在一个多边形内部,由两个相邻边所夹的角。求解阴影角集合可以帮助我们了解多边形的内部结构。

2. 使用三角函数求解

以一个三角形为例,我们可以使用以下步骤求解阴影角集合:

  1. 计算角度:使用三角函数计算三角形每个内角的大小。
  2. 求和:将三角形内角求和,得到180度(或π弧度)。
  3. 求解阴影角:通过减去已知的角,得到阴影角。

例如,一个三角形的两个角分别为30度和60度,那么第三个角(阴影角)为:

[ \text{阴影角} = 180^\circ - 30^\circ - 60^\circ = 90^\circ ]

3. 示例代码

以下是一个使用Python计算三角形阴影角的示例代码:

import math

# 定义三角形的两个角
angle1 = math.radians(30)  # 30度转换为弧度
angle2 = math.radians(60)  # 60度转换为弧度

# 计算阴影角
shadow_angle = 180 - angle1 - angle2

# 输出结果
print(f"三角形的阴影角为:{math.degrees(shadow_angle)}度")

三、三角函数在几何难题中的应用

1. 求解三角形面积

使用海伦公式,我们可以通过三角形的边长和角度求解面积。以下是海伦公式的示例代码:

def calculate_triangle_area(a, b, c):
    # 计算半周长
    s = (a + b + c) / 2
    # 计算面积
    area = math.sqrt(s * (s - a) * (s - b) * (s - c))
    return area

# 示例:求解边长为3、4、5的三角形面积
area = calculate_triangle_area(3, 4, 5)
print(f"三角形的面积为:{area}平方单位")

2. 求解多边形内角和

对于任意多边形,其内角和可以通过以下公式计算:

[ \text{内角和} = (n - 2) \times 180^\circ ]

其中,n是多边形的边数。

结论

三角函数在几何学中具有广泛的应用。通过掌握三角函数的基本知识和应用技巧,我们可以轻松求解阴影角集合,解决各种几何难题。希望本文能帮助您更好地理解三角函数的奥秘。